Installation Options
Depending on your site and ground conditions, timber bases can be installed as either:
Freestanding Base
A solid raised frame supported by timber legs, ideal for when you already have an existing hardstanding base in place, such as concrete or tarmac.
This type of timber base sits neatly on top of the existing surface, raising the building slightly for improved airflow and protection.
Concreted-In Base
Where extra stability is needed, legs can be concreted into the ground for a stronger permanent foundation.
